Ingredients
Scale
Sliders
- 12 pieces soft slider rolls (Keep them connected for easy slicing and serving)
- 8 ounces thinly sliced deli ham (Choose a high-quality ham for maximum flavor)
- 6 slices Swiss cheese (The creamy texture melts beautifully in the oven)
Topping & Glaze
- 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 teaspoon poppy seeds
- 1/2 teaspoon dried minced onion
- 2 teaspoons honey
- Pinch black pepper
Instructions
-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a 9×13-inch baking pan with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
- Prepare Rolls: Slice the slider rolls horizontally, keeping them connected to create a cohesive sandwich base and top.
- Assemble Bottom Layer: Place the bottom half of the sliced rolls in the prepared pan. Layer half of the deli ham evenly across the rolls.
- Add Cheese and Ham: Arrange all six slices of Swiss cheese over the ham, then add the remaining deli ham on top of the cheese layer.
- Top with Roll Slab: Carefully place the top half of the slider rolls back onto the sandwich stack to close it.
- Make Glaze: In a small bowl, whisk together melted unsalted butter, Dijon mustard, Worcestershire sauce, poppy seeds, dried minced onion, honey, and a pinch of black pepper until well combined.
- Brush Glaze: Generously brush the butter and honey glaze evenly over the top of the slider rolls, ensuring good coverage for flavor and browning.
- Bake Covered: Loosely cover the sliders with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 15 minutes to meld flavors and warm through.
- Brown Tops: Remove the foil and continue baking for an additional 3 to 5 minutes, or until the tops are glossy and golden brown.
- Rest and Serve: Let the sliders rest for 5 minutes outside the oven before slicing into 12 individual pieces for serving.
Notes
- Keeping the slider rolls connected while slicing makes assembly and serving much easier.
- Using high-quality deli ham enhances the overall flavor of the sliders.
- Feel free to substitute Swiss cheese with Gruyere or mozzarella for a different taste profile.
- You can prepare the glaze ahead of time and refrigerate until ready to use.
- These sliders are best enjoyed warm but can also be reheated gently before serving.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
